ABOUT THE BOOK:

In the heart of the California wine country, secrets seem to grow on the vines with the grapes that Uriel Macon’s family has carefully tended for generations. Uriel Macon, the winery’s young widower, steers clear of complicated relationships other than the one he’s developed with the horse he rides daily. He plans to stick to the lonely comfort of wine and horses forever, but for a chance encounter with the wealthy local, Jim Scanlon. Uriel is reminded of his love affair with Jim’s daughter Amanda years ago, that ended abruptly, and mysteriously. Amanda Scanlon is simultaneously pulled back to Sonoma after years of traveling, due to a family crisis. In the Scanlon’s Spanish villa high above the valley, Amanda faces the broken relationships she left behind. An anthropologist by training, Amanda’s instinct is to demand the truth concerning her parents’ complicated history and her own parentage. But Amanda’s unveiling of the past has devastating consequences, and the Scanlon’s lives are changed forever. In contrast to the setting of California’s beautiful Sonoma Valley, the Scanlons struggle to face harsh challenges with dignity and grace, over the course of one year. Their fate is surprisingly intertwined with the Macons. Both Amanda and Uriel stretch to take care of their families as they face immigration, divorce, loss, and illness. As they navigate these challenges, they must decide whether they trust themselves to love again, or to finally let each other go. A Sonoma local, Joanell Serra offers a debut novel that is a captivating, poignant, and uplifting story, demonstrating that the seeds planted long ago continue to grow. Sometimes into a strangling weed, sometimes offering a bountiful harvest.




BIO

Joanell Serra, MFT lives with her growing children, husband and dogs in the lovely Sonoma Valley. After years of publishing short stories, essays and plays, The Vines We Planted is her debut novel. She can be found polishing her second novel at a coffee shop, sipping a perfect Cabernet in a Sonoma winery or at her website: www.JoanellSerraAuthor.com.
